Sydney Sweeney Nears Deal for Lead Role in Live-Action Gundam Film

Sydney Sweeney, known for her role in *Madame Web* and HBO’s *Euphoria*, is reportedly in final negotiations to star in the upcoming live-action adaptation of the iconic anime franchise *Mobile Suit Gundam*. This marks another high-profile venture for the actress, who continues to build a diverse filmography across genres.

In February, it was officially announced that the live-action *Mobile Suit Gundam* film had entered production, with Bandai Namco and Legendary Entertainment co-financing the project. The movie, which currently does not have an official title, will be written and directed by Kim Mickle, best known as the showrunner of *Sweet Tooth*. It is set for a global theatrical release, although no specific release date has been revealed yet.

A teaser poster has already been released, offering fans a first glimpse into the ambitious project. While plot details remain under wraps, the film aims to honor the legacy of the original series, which revolutionized the robot anime genre when it debuted in 1979. Unlike earlier "super robot" anime, *Mobile Suit Gundam* introduced the concept of "real robots" — machines treated as weapons of war, grounded in realism with complex human drama and moral ambiguity.

According to reports from Variety, Sydney Sweeney is set to play a key role in the film, though specifics about her character or the storyline have not yet been disclosed. Her recent projects include *The White Lotus*, *Reality*, and *Anyone but You*, following her lead role in *Madame Web*, which unfortunately did not perform well critically or commercially.

Sweeney has also recently signed on to produce and star in a horror film based on a viral Reddit thread, showcasing her interest in unique and fan-driven storytelling. Meanwhile, fans of the *Gundam* franchise eagerly await further updates from Bandai Namco and Legendary, who have promised to reveal more information as it becomes available.

As stated previously by the studios: “We plan to steadily announce details as they become finalized.” With its deep narrative roots and growing cast, the *Mobile Suit Gundam* live-action film remains one of the most anticipated adaptations in the world of anime-to-live-action translations.
